Planning appeal decision

Dismissed31 July 20233299670

9 Marine Gardens, MARGATE, CT9 1UN

described on the application form as ‘the proposal reconfigures the existing ground floor retail unit which is altered to be accommodated across the ground and lower ground floor. The equivalent area of the existing lower ground floor B1 unit is replaced with a new 1 bed flats at lower ground floor and an alteration at ground floor level that extends the existing 1 bedroom flat into a new three bedroom apartment. The residential units at upper floors remain unaltered

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• whether a satisfactory standard of accommodation would be provided for future occupiers, with particular regard to play space
  • the effect of the proposed development on the integrity of the Thanet Coast and Sandwich Bay Special Protection Area

What decided it

The absence of planning obligations to secure either play space provision or financial contributions towards SPA mitigation measures rendered the development unacceptable on both main issues.

Framework references: 130, 180

Plan policies cited: Policy GI04, Policy SP29
